A Study Of Student Satisfaction With College English In Blended Learning Environment

Blended learning is a popular learning approach as it integrates face-to-face teaching with web-based online learning.In recent years,as blended learning has developed rapidly,colleges and universities have begun to apply and practice blended learning mode one after another.As an underlying indicator reflecting learning and teaching effect,student satisfaction has gradually attracted attention by scholars at home and abroad.However,there are still very limited studies on the satisfaction of blended learning.Shandong Normal University carried out the reform of College English and implemented the blended learning based on hierarchical teaching in 2016.So far,blended learning has lasted for two years,and the teaching effect has gradually emerged.In view of this,the study of the student satisfaction with College English will help to learn about the teaching and learning effect and find out the existing problems in the teaching and learning process,so as to provide enlightments for improving College English teaching and learning.In this study,6 College English teachers and 3184 non-English majors in Shandong Normal University are selected as the participants.Questionnaires and an interview are employed to collect data.This study mainly addresses the following questions:(1)What is the general situation of the student satisfaction with College English in blended learning environment?(2)What is the specific situation of the student satisfaction in terms of the seven dimensions of the satisfaction scale?(3)Are there any differences in student satisfaction among the students of different genders,majors and English levels? If there are differences,what are they?The major findings are summarized as follows:The overall satisfaction of the students towards blended learning is relatively high.The descending order of student satisfaction is teaching ability,learning support,perceived ease of technology use,learning satisfaction,self-efficacy,perceived usefulness of technology,and learning motivation.Besides,the proportion of people with neutral attitude is relatively large,and there is still much room for improvement of student satisfaction with blended learning of College English.Through analyzing the seven dimensions,it can be found that although the satisfaction with perceived ease of technology use is high,students are less satisfied with the functions of notification,news and discussion posts on the platform.In terms of perceived usefulness of technology,student satisfaction with teacher-student interaction and student-student interaction is lower than the average of this dimension.In terms of gender,there are significant differences in self-efficacy,learning motivation and perceived ease of technology use.The self-efficacy of male students is higher than that of female students,and the learning motivation and perceived ease of technology use for female students are higher than that of male students.In terms of majors,there are differences only in learning motivation between liberal arts and science students,and the learning motivation of liberal arts students is higher than that of science students.In terms of English levels,there are significant differences in the two dimensions of learning motivation and teaching ability.For the dimension of learning motivation,student satisfaction of advanced level is significantly higher than intermediate level,and intermediate level is significantly higher than elementary level.For the dimension of teaching ability,student satisfaction of advanced level is also significantly higher than intermediate level,and intermediate level is significantly higher than elementary level.According to the above findings,the author puts forward some suggestions on how to improve the blended learning model and further improve the overall satisfaction of students.Finally,the limitations and shortcomings of this study are pointed out,and some suggestions for future improvement are put forward.
